Even The Buildings Smile
Soon we will end the weekend and move into the next workweek.
As a kid, I remember people calling it "Blue Monday"--presumably because of the feelings people had going back to work.
I know some people that don't even like to go out on Sunday evening at all, because of the anxiety they feel about the upcoming week.
But I thought this was a great photo that my daughter took to express the weekend joy and good feelings and the importance of carrying these forward throughout the whole week.
Someone actually drew this smiley face on the side of the building!
When my other daughter, Minna, asked my mom in the nursing home today for some words of wisdom, she reminded us all that "the years go by all too quickly!"
In her words, I understood that the main thing is to find meaning and purpose, give more than you take, and remember to count your blessings every day. ;-)
